National brand work, and what it actually involved

A logo wall proves nothing. These are the programme types behind the names, because the transferable skill is multi-jurisdiction permitting and building inside operating properties without shutting them down.

Restaurant & QSR

Taco Bell / KFC / Pizza Hut / 7-Eleven

Multi-site restaurant and convenience programmes: prototype adaptation to each site, health department and fire sequencing, and permitting across separate jurisdictions on one schedule.

Retail & mixed use

Westfield / GNC / Luxottica / Williams-Sonoma

Retail build-outs and centre work inside operating properties: landlord work letter coordination, phased construction around trading hours, and centre-management approvals.

Hospitality

Hilton / Hilton Garden Inn / Edition

Hospitality renovation and fit-out work in occupied properties, phased floor by floor so rooms and public areas stayed in service.

Corporate, finance & tech

Citibank / AT&T / Uber / Pluto TV / Amgen / CBRE

Corporate and office tenant improvements: change of occupancy, accessibility upgrades, MEP coordination and weekly cost and schedule reporting to the tenant and landlord.

Questions we answer before the first call

Where does Plantek West work?

Southern California, with offices in Santa Monica and Fullerton. We regularly work across Los Angeles, Orange, Ventura, Riverside and San Bernardino counties, and we have delivered multi-site programs beyond the region for national brands.

What is a feasibility study and do I need one?

A feasibility study is a short, paid assessment that answers whether a project can be built, at what approximate cost, under what approvals, and in what timeframe. It is the cheapest way to avoid spending design fees on a project the code, the site or the budget will not support.

How do you charge?

Feasibility work is a fixed fee. Design and construction management are typically fee-based on project value or scope, and construction is contracted with a defined line-item budget. You will always see how the number is built before you sign.

Are you helping homeowners rebuilding after the Eaton and Palisades fires?

Yes. We support rebuild efforts with design and plan submittal help so owners can move through approvals faster. Rebuild projects are prioritized in our intake.
